Senior Pre-Construction Estimator

Summary

The Senior Estimator provides full-time support to the Vice President of Pre-Construction. The Senior Estimator frequently interacting with clients and contractors. This role assists management in preparing work to be estimated, gathering proposals, blueprints, specifications, and other related documents. Identifying labor, materials, and time requirements for projects, attend bid meetings, owner meetings, and other meetings with stakeholders and work alongside of the estimating team to prepare budgets in a timely manner.
